The strategy published today, Thursday April 7, 2022, sets out how Great Britain will ramp up its domestic energy provision to ensure security of supply.
We are encouraged that the Government has included nuclear power as a crucial part of the energy mix, accelerating delivery with up to eight new reactors that could be delivered.
We further welcome the ambition of up to 24GW of electricity to come from nuclear energy by 2050, representing up to 25 percent of Britain’s projected energy demand, with Small Modular Reactors (SMRs) becoming a key part of the pipeline. Pushing ahead with the Sizewell C nuclear project alone, for example, would produce the equivalent of 5.4 billion cubic metres of gas per year
Urenco is pleased to have been a part of the Government’s engagement with industry prior to the release of the strategy.
Emilie Isaacs, Head of Government Affairs for Urenco, said: “The strategy provides a positive way forward for the nuclear industry as a whole, and we are ready to play our part and support the Government to deliver on these commitments.
“We’ll need both nuclear and renewable energy sources to achieve a secure and reliable supply, and the strategy builds on the Prime Minister’s plan for a Green Industrial Revolution.
“We are clear on this: nuclear energy is safe and clean and can provide consistent, low carbon electricity.”

About Urenco
Urenco is an international supplier of enrichment services and fuel cycle products with sustainability at the core of its business. Operating in a pivotal area of the nuclear fuel supply chain for 50 years, Urenco facilitates zero carbon electricity generation for consumers around the world.
With its head office near London, UK, Urenco’s global presence ensures diversity and security of supply for customers through enrichment facilities in Germany, the Netherlands, the UK and the USA. Using centrifuge technology designed and developed by Urenco, and through the expertise of our people, the Urenco Group provides safe, cost effective and reliable services; operating within a framework of high environmental, social and governance standards, complementing international safeguards.
Urenco is committed to continued investment in the responsible management of nuclear materials; innovation activities with clear sustainability benefits, such as nuclear medicine, industrial efficiency and research; and nurturing the next generation of scientists and engineers.
